While you're not wrong, there's two things I've got to say. First, the designs. Most of the classic MechWarrior designs were licensed japanese anime designs. You probably knew that already, but bears mentioning anyway.

Second, lore-wise, MechWarrior's battlemechs are anything but slow and lumbersome. They're originally described as running and leaping with animalistic movements, ducking and weaving, pulling moves that put pro gymnasts to shame. Lorewise it's the synthetic muscles and neural helmets doing their thing to make the 'mechs agile as all hell. Tabletop Battletech also had the Land-Air Mechs - macross/robotech inspired units that were zipping around the battlefield at mach 3.
The whole "MechWarrior is slow" thing started with video games - as beloved and a good game MechWarrior 2 is, it's really not lore accurate.

Go nagai created the genre.
Gundam started in 1979
Mazinger was 1972
Grendizer was 75
Steel Jeeg was 75

But even he was inspired by Tetsujin 28-go which was 1956
